x360ce version 2.0.2.163 is a historically stable, lightweight, and effective emulation layer for running non-Xbox controllers with XInput-based games on Windows. While superseded by newer versions with better 64-bit and wireless support, it remains a reliable fallback for 32-bit titles and low-resource environments. Its design principle—local, file-based redirection without persistent services—makes it a textbook example of practical reverse engineering for compatibility.
